What Makes the GTS Different?
GTS stands for speed, stability, and versatility — and Titleist built each model to deliver on all three. The biggest structural change from the previous GT lineup is the Split Mass Frame, which repositions weight at two separate points across the driver head to optimize CG location for each specific model.
The result is more precise control over launch and spin than Titleist has been able to offer in a single driver family before. Each model in the GTS lineup has a distinct personality built for a distinct player type.
The Three Models: GTS2, GTS3, and GTS4
Titleist GTS2 — The Versatile Choice
The GTS2 is the mid-point of the lineup — a genuinely versatile driver that works across a wide range of player types. It's forgiving enough for most golfers but doesn't sacrifice workability. If you're not sure which GTS is right for you, start here.
- CG location: Mid-forward for neutral launch and spin
- Forgiveness: High
- Best for: Mid to high swing speeds, players who want a reliable, consistent driver without fuss
Titleist GTS3 — The Player's Driver
The GTS3 is the tour-inspired option — a more compact, workable head built for better players who want to shape shots and control their ball flight. Lower spin, penetrating launch, tighter dispersion.
- CG location: Forward and low for low spin
- Forgiveness: Moderate
- Best for: Scratch to low-handicap players, 100+ mph swing speeds, players who want to work the ball
Titleist GTS4 — Maximum Forgiveness
The GTS4 is built for distance and forgiveness above all else. Higher launch, more spin than the GTS3, and a larger footprint that puts MOI at the top of the class.
- CG location: Back and high for high launch
- Forgiveness: Maximum
- Best for: Mid-handicap players, those who struggle with consistency off the tee
| Model | Launch | Spin | Forgiveness |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| GTS2 | Mid | Mid | High | Most players |
| GTS3 | Low | Low | Moderate | Low handicap |
| GTS4 | High | Mid-High | Maximum | Game improvement |
Shaft Options: Standard vs Premium
Titleist offers two shaft tiers for the GTS lineup and the difference matters more than most people realize.
Standard Shafts ($699):
- Project X Titan Black — low launch, stable, built for faster swingers
- Mitsubishi Tensei 1K White — mid-high launch, smoother feel, wider range of players
- Mitsubishi Tensei 1K Blue — mid launch, versatile
- Mitsubishi Tensei 1K Red — low launch, tour feel
Premium Shafts ($899):
- Graphite Design Tour AD DI — penetrating flight, ultra-stable, low spin
- Graphite Design Tour AD VF — variable flex profile, smooth through the bag
- Graphite Design Tour AD FI — optimized for fairways but plays well in drivers
